Equivalent & Substitute Parts for PDTA124XT/APGR

Part Overview

PDTA124XT/APGR from Nexperia USA Inc. is a pre-biased PNP bipolar junction transistor (BJT) designed for general-purpose amplification and switching applications. The product is in a surface-mount TO-236AB (SOT-23-3) package, offers a maximum collector-emitter voltage of 50 V, a maximum collector current of 100 mA, and standard pre-biasing resistors (R1: 22 kOhms, R2: 47 kOhms). The product is currently listed as obsolete, necessitating the identification of fully compatible substitute models to ensure continued design and manufacturing support.

Substitute Part Grouping Explanation

Substitute parts are grouped strictly by matching the electrical and mechanical parameters critical to the operation and physical replacement of the PDTA124XT/APGR. The following parameters are used to determine substitutability for the pre-biased PNP bipolar transistor category:

  • Transistor type (PNP - Pre-Biased)
  • Collector-emitter voltage rating (50 V)
  • Maximum collector current (100 mA)
  • Base and emitter resistor values (22 kOhms, 47 kOhms)
  • DC current gain (minimum 80 @ 5mA, 5V)
  • Vce saturation voltage (maximum 150 mV @ 500µA, 10mA)
  • Package and mounting type (TO-236-3, SOT-23-3)
  • RoHS and REACH compliance

Only parts meeting all these parameters are considered direct substitutes.

Engineering Selection Recommendations

PDTA124XT/APGR is classified as obsolete. For continued procurement and manufacturing, select PDTA124XT,215 as a substitute based on matching product compliance (ROHS3, REACH, ECCN EAR99), package type (TO-236AB), electrical parameters, and certified surface mount compatibility. The substitute part is currently active and available in inventory. The substitute also maintains the same moisture sensitivity rating.
